The starter relay is usually found in the engine compartment fuse box. Refer to your vehicle’s manual for the. A starter relay sends small electric power to the starter solenoid when you turn on the ignition key, while the solenoid draws a large current directly from the car batteries. They serve two different purposes. The starter relay is crucial but often overlooked in ignition systems. The starter solenoid is located on the starter motor, and a starter relay is in most cases located in the fuse box in the engine compartment.
